'Doctor Who': Noel Clarke not expecting 50th anniversary return
Published Jun 27 2012, 12:18 BST | By Morgan Jeffery and Emma Dibdin
Noel Clarke has suggested that a return to Doctor Who is unlikely.Speculation is rife that former Who cast members may return to the show for its 50th anniversary in November 2013, but Clarke told Digital Spy that he does not expect to appear in any celebratory episode.
"I'm sure if I was gonna be there, I'd know about it already," said the 36-year-old actor - who played Mickey Smith between 2005 and 2010.
"I'm not chasing it and I'm not... begging for it. I do my own thing and they do their thing. If they called me, then I'm sure there'd be a conversation, but I'm not calling them or chasing it."
Clarke added that he has continued to watch Doctor Who following his departure from the series, adding that he is a fan of current lead Matt Smith.
"I love what Matt brings to it and I'm sure the 50th anniversary will be no holds barred, I'm sure it'll be great," he said.
Noel Clarke's new film Storage 24 is released to cinemas this Friday (June 29).
